The History of February's Birthstone:
Amethyst
Amethyst, the birthstone of February, is a type of quartz that is characterised by its purple hue. The history of this stone dates all the way back to early Greece, with the name derived from the Greek 'amethystos' which means 'not intoxicating.' The Ancient Greeks thought the stone was connected to the god of wine, Bacchus, due to its rich colour, similar to wine. Both the Ancient Greek and the Romans believed that wearing February birthstone jewellery would help to ward off the unwanted effects of alcohol.
The colour purple has long been associated with Royalty, and in times gone by this was a very popular birthstone for the ruling class to wear. Before the discovery of lots of amethysts, it was held in the same regard as diamond jewellery. Today amethyst jewellery is the most popular of the purple gemstones to wear.

The Meaning of February's Birthstone
Each birthstone has its own meanings, all of which have evolved over time. The added sentiment makes birthstone jewellery an even more special gift, as it represents more than just their birthday. Amethyst's symbolism stems primarily from its historic uses as a way to ward off the effects of alcohol. Today February's birthstone is thought to promote clarity of mind, a sense of calm, as well as symbolising empowerment and wisdom. It is also seen as a stone of love, with the legends stating that Saint Valentine created a ring of amethyst with an image of cupid carved into the stone. What Colour is February's Birthstone?
February's birthstone is Amethyst, a gemstone renowned for its captivating shades of violet. The mesmerizing color of Amethyst is a result of the presence of iron and other transition metals within the quartz. This semi-precious gemstone exhibits a wide range of hues, spanning from delicate pale lavender to a sumptuously deep shade of purple. How to Care for Amethyst Jewellery
Amethyst scores a 7 on the Mohs scale of gemstone hardness, making it ideal for everyday jewellery due to its durability. However, to keep your birthstone necklace looking its best, it's important to know how to take proper care of it:
- Clean with a soft brush or cloth and lukewarm, soapy water.
- Avoid submerging the stone in water as this could cause the gem to become loose.
- Don't expose your amethyst to harsh chemicals as these could damage the stone.
- Keep your gemstone jewellery safe in a jewellery box when not being worn.
